Output d408bb312630bf6b350275310ccbf035d2ab543900e0eaf97f992eb59816f496:5

value
2144138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5102e7427b98d61826f76ec5914f7783129e16a8 OP_EQUAL
address
395N8oz4SahXoQYVT3eqMvJDW64diuAfK5
transaction
d408bb312630bf6b350275310ccbf035d2ab543900e0eaf97f992eb59816f496